Assessment criteria, approved/failed

Local Area Networks (CCNA1):
Understands layered system models, characteristics of LAN, structured cabling, common equipment used in local area networks and applications. Understands the basics of TCP/IP-protocol and subnetting.

Internetworks (CCNA2):
Understands the basic features and arrangements of routing.

Virtual Local Area Networks (CCNA 3):
Understands the design and operational principles of the switched local area network.

Wide Area Networks (CCNA 4):
Understands the basic principles of address translations, access control lists and wide area network connections.
